Output 31efd1ef6a54ddccd82f231bd6b75a28e393e85e42c6e364e6527b6aaacc7954:2

value
43562453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 508b79b70c07725852ea13a53a03dd2d69368469 OP_EQUAL
address
MFF3NhbXGsUW5YuTjHTVAZMWkK5t2zC5pY
transaction
31efd1ef6a54ddccd82f231bd6b75a28e393e85e42c6e364e6527b6aaacc7954
spent
true